The Yang lab benefits from multiple ongoing collaborations at the University of Pittsburgh and beyond: the computational expertise of Dr. Wissam Saidi (Department of Mechanical Engineering and Materials Science) and resources provided by the Center for Research Computing (CRC) make possible atomic-scale in silico validation of our results. Membership in the Environmental TEM Catalysis Consortium (ECC) also enables cooperation between the materials science and chemical engineering communities at Pitt, aiding our multidisciplinary work. Our efforts are supported by funds from the National Science Foundation and supplemented by partnership with Brookhaven National Laboratory and the State University of New York at Binghamton.
